About Rekha

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Rekha village is 334471. Rekha village is located in Diamond Harbour Ii subdivision of South Twenty Four Parganas district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 3.9km away from sub-district headquarter Sarisha (tehsildar office) and 39.3km away from district headquarter Alipore. As per 2009 stats, Mathur is the gram panchayat of Rekha village.

The total geographical area of village is 84.82 hectares. Rekha has a total population of 856 peoples, out of which male population is 448 while female population is 408.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 910 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of rekha village is 68.11% out of which 70.31% males and 65.69% females are literate. There are about 191 houses in rekha village. Pincode of rekha village locality is 743368.

When it comes to administration, Rekha village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Rekha village comes under Diamond harbour Vidhan Sabha constituency & Diamond Harbour Lok Sabha constituency. Diamond Harbour is nearest town to rekha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.
